Find the value of x needed to make the equation true

X-18=34

Answer:

x = 52

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the value of x, you'll have to work backwards.  And when the equation is subtraction, then you'll have to add 34 and 18 together.  This gives you 52.  To check your answer, input 52 in the position of x.  52 - 18 = 34.
